Output e6bbd0771d53a3b626b6e1800fe9b7c28c781758fde93ae0cb9982cb60065d9e:1

value
53154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 569ba5ccec18a0e38da5efd53befb5dd8744b866 OP_EQUALVERIFY OP_CHECKSIG
address
18twa61J5X61dNARyCdaWvq9rTUPetpTqz
transaction
e6bbd0771d53a3b626b6e1800fe9b7c28c781758fde93ae0cb9982cb60065d9e
spent
true